I would expect someone with low thyroid hormone to metabolize testosterone more slowly and higher thyroid hormone to increase the metabolism of testosterone. The same is true for other hormones such as bilirubin clearance, studies show faster clearance of other hormones of hyperthyroid patients and the slower clearance when a patient has hypothyroidism.
